Common IT Problems Managed Services Solve

Before you choose a provider, look at the specific problems that push Sacramento businesses to outsource their IT or switch from a vendor that no longer keeps up.

📉

Unpredictable IT Costs

Break-fix billing creates budget uncertainty. A single server failure or ransomware incident can cost a Sacramento SMB $60,000 to $250,000 or more. Flat-fee managed IT turns that risk into a predictable, affordable monthly line item you can plan around.

⏱️

Downtime Costs Revenue

Industry research pegs average IT downtime in the thousands of dollars per minute. For a 50-person Sacramento agency or practice, even a 4-hour outage can run $25,000 to $50,000 in lost productivity and recovery labor, which is why reliable uptime matters.

🔒

Cybersecurity Gaps

Sacramento's government, healthcare, and finance base makes it a high-value target. Most SMBs cannot staff 24/7 network monitoring, EDR, and incident response in house, so managed cybersecurity that can detect and respond to threats fast is often the first reason a business calls an MSP.

📋

Compliance Pressure

CCPA and CPRA apply broadly across California, HIPAA governs the large healthcare sector, and CJIS and StateRAMP weigh on government-adjacent firms. Staying compliant under these frameworks, and the contract terms tied to them, can exceed an unmanaged IT budget.

☀️

Hybrid and Multi-Site Complexity

Sacramento teams are spread from Downtown to Roseville, Folsom, and Davis, or fully remote and Bay-adjacent. Securing hybrid, multi-site environments and keeping every endpoint protected takes more than a traditional break-fix vendor can deliver.

📈

IT That Cannot Scale With Growth

Sacramento's growing tech, agtech, and professional services firms outpace their IT during expansion. A provider with a scalable, co-managed it model can add users, devices, and sites quickly, so growth never stalls waiting on an internal hire.

What's Included in Managed IT Services?

Managed IT covers several stacked layers, not one flat plan. The list below shows the functions Sacramento providers usually bundle at each level of coverage.

🛡️

Fully Managed IT

Most Requested

Your provider becomes the entire IT function. With no in-house technicians on payroll, the MSP owns every system, ticket, and vendor relationship.

  • Round-the-clock remote monitoring and alerts (RMM)
  • Unlimited helpdesk across Tier 1, 2 & 3
  • Patch management for endpoints & servers
  • Antivirus and EDR (Endpoint Detection & Response)
  • Data backup and disaster recovery (BDR)
  • Network upkeep across firewall, switches, and Wi-Fi
  • Microsoft 365 and Azure administration
  • Staff onboarding and offboarding
  • vCIO input and quarterly IT strategy reviews
  • Vendor coordination and procurement

Best for: Small and mid-size firms of 10–150 users running without in-house IT

🤝

Co-Managed IT

Rising Demand

Your in-house IT staff runs daily operations while the provider covers overflow, plugs skill gaps, and supplies specialist depth on demand.

  • NOC (Network Operations Center) overflow capacity
  • Evening and weekend helpdesk cover
  • Security specialists and vCISO services
  • Cloud design and migration projects
  • Compliance program oversight
  • Heavy project work (ERP, infrastructure refreshes)
  • Shared access to RMM and PSA tooling
  • Team training and skill augmentation
  • Backup and DR supervision
  • Executive reporting and board-level briefings

Best for: Growing companies of 50–500 users backed by 1–5 internal IT staff

How Sacramento MSPs Structure Their Support Tiers

Tier 1: Front-Line Fixes

Covers password resets, everyday connectivity, app installs, printer faults, and M365 user requests. Most close in under 30 minutes, worked by front-line helpdesk staff.

Tier 2: Deeper Diagnosis

Handles server faults, network trouble, security incidents, tangled application errors, and failed backups. Escalated to senior technicians who hold deeper system access.

Tier 3: Deep Engineering

Owns infrastructure design, cloud architecture, large migrations, live disaster-recovery execution, and in-depth security investigations. Run by senior engineers and solution architects.

IT Compliance Requirements for Sacramento Industries

Sacramento's government and healthcare base creates heavy compliance duties under California and federal law. The right provider should understand every framework that touches your business and build the controls to keep you compliant.

🔐
CCPA & CPRA: California Privacy
Most Sacramento businesses

California's privacy laws, CCPA and CPRA, apply broadly to any business handling consumer data. Look for providers that build privacy controls, data-mapping, and breach-notification readiness directly into their managed services rather than bolting them on later.

🏛️
CJIS & StateRAMP: Government
State agencies, contractors

Firms working with state and local government face CJIS and StateRAMP expectations. A capable provider aligns controls, logging, and continuous monitoring to public-sector requirements and can show the documentation auditors ask for.

🏥
HIPAA: Healthcare
UC Davis, Sutter, Kaiser

Sacramento's healthcare base demands HIPAA-compliant IT across EHR systems, email, and remote access. Look for providers with documented Business Associate Agreements, encrypted backups, and annual risk assessments that keep protected health data secure.

🧩
SOC 2 & PCI-DSS: Tech & Finance
Folsom tech, financial services

Technology and finance firms increasingly need SOC 2 Type II and PCI-DSS to win enterprise clients and handle cardholder data. A capable provider supplies the access controls, logging, and audit-ready evidence those standards require.

🚩 Red Flags to Watch For

  • No NOC: all monitoring done manually by on-call staff
  • Vague contracts without defined response-time SLAs
  • No cyber liability insurance, or will not share the certificate
  • No experience with government or HIPAA compliance for regulated clients
  • Cannot provide client references in your industry

10 Questions to Ask Every Sacramento MSP Before You Sign

01What is your guaranteed remote response time as a contractual SLA, not just a target?
02Do you operate your own NOC and SOC, or is monitoring outsourced?
03How many technicians are local to the Sacramento metro versus remote?
04Can you show me your last 90 days of CSAT scores?
05What security stack do you deploy, and do you run 24/7 monitoring?
06How do you support CCPA, CJIS, or HIPAA compliance for my data?
07Do you carry cyber liability insurance, and what is the coverage limit?
08Walk me through your first 30 days of onboarding.
09Have you worked with companies in my industry? Can I speak to one?
10What is your process when a critical incident hits at 2am on a Sunday?

Sacramento Managed IT: Buyer's Guide

Most Sacramento managed IT providers charge about $100 to $200 per user per month for fully managed IT, or $100 to $200 per hour for break-fix and project work. Regulated healthcare and finance clients sit at the higher end because of added security and compliance work. Ask each provider what is bundled into the per-user rate so you can compare quotes on the same basis.
A standard Sacramento managed IT plan includes 24/7 monitoring, a help desk, patching and updates, endpoint security, and backup, usually for a flat per-user monthly fee. Major projects, new hardware, deep compliance audits, and large migrations are typically quoted separately. Get the line between recurring service and one-time project work in writing before you sign.
Managed IT gives a Sacramento business a flat monthly fee and proactive coverage, which fits firms that need predictable uptime. Break-fix ($100 to $200 per hour) can work for very small offices that rarely need support but leaves you exposed between incidents. A full in-house hire costs more once you include benefits and after-hours gaps, so many teams choose co-managed IT to extend the staff they have.
Choose a Sacramento MSP on verified reviews, a written service level agreement, and clear pricing, not marketing claims. Confirm the help desk is local or in-country and not offshored, ask for client references in your industry, and have them walk through their security stack. The providers on this page are ranked on real Google ratings and verified company data so you can shortlist three and compare.
Ask every Sacramento provider for a written response time in their service level agreement. Strong MSPs acknowledge critical, business-down issues within about 15 to 60 minutes and staff a 24/7 help desk for after-hours coverage. A response time you can hold them to in writing matters more than a vague promise of fast support.
Many Sacramento providers offer 24/7 monitoring and after-hours support, but coverage varies, so confirm it. Ask whether the help desk is staffed in-house and in-country or outsourced to an offshore call center, because that drives both response speed and how well technicians know your environment.
Most Sacramento MSPs bundle managed detection and response, multi-factor authentication, patching, backup and disaster recovery, and security-awareness training, with dark-web monitoring and a 24/7 SOC on higher tiers. Ask which controls are included in the base plan versus sold as add-ons, since that is where quotes diverge most.
Sacramento providers commonly support CCPA & CPRA, CJIS & StateRAMP, HIPAA, and SOC 2 & PCI-DSS, aligning the right controls, documentation, and audit evidence to each. Tell a provider your specific obligation up front and ask for proof they have taken a client through that exact framework, not just general familiarity with it.
Common Sacramento specialties include healthcare, finance, and professional services, plus professional services and small-to-midsize businesses across the metro. An MSP that already supports firms in your sector will know your software, compliance needs, and workflows, which shortens onboarding and reduces risk.
Yes. Co-managed IT lets a Sacramento provider extend your internal staff rather than replace it, covering after-hours support, security, and specialized projects while your team keeps day-to-day control. It is a common fit for organizations that have one or two IT people who are stretched thin.
A good Sacramento MSP starts with a discovery and documentation phase, then a phased cutover planned around your schedule to keep downtime minimal. Ask any provider to walk through their onboarding and transition plan, how they handle your existing tools and data, and what the first 30 days look like.
